Chef's tips: (1) Warming the milk slightly is crucial. If the milk is ice-cold, it will cause the melted butter to seize up and clump. (2) Granulated sugar is important not just for sweetness, but also to tenderize the crumb and help caramelize the edges for a crispy, golden exterior. (3) Do not overmix the batter. Overmixing develops gluten, which makes the pancakes tough instead of light and fluffy. (4) Cook over medium-low heat. If the heat is too high, the sugar in the batter will burn the outside before the inside is fully cooked.
